M54.6
ICD-10-CMThis code represents non-specific pain localized to the thoracic region of the spine. It indicates discomfort or ache in the mid-back area that is not attributed to a specific underlying spinal pathology like disc disease or fracture.
Use this code when documentation clearly states "thoracic back pain" or "mid-back pain" without further specification of a definitive cause. It is appropriate for cases where imaging or clinical assessment has ruled out disc disorders, radiculopathy, or other specific spinal conditions.
